Gary HeatlyEver since he can remember Gary Heatly has had a love for sport and a love for writing. While he was at school growing up in Edinburgh he set about combining the two and began to write match reports for rugby and cricket matches that his friends were playing in.

That progressed to getting involved in the school magazine and then writing for the university newspaper and so on.

Having cut his teeth in the ‘real world’ at the Midlothian Advertiser newspaper for a couple of years he has since been kept busy as a member of the editorial team at SCRUM Magazine – Scotland’s only dedicated rugby union title – whilst providing regular sports content to various national newspapers and websites.
